In Episode 4 of Lessons From a Reluctant Entrepreneur, Mike Konrad shares the awkward, funny, and very real story of what happened after launching his company. He had the logo, the business cards, the office supplies, the used desk, and the company name.
What he didn’t have was a finished product, a brochure, specifications, photos, pricing, or anything resembling a polished sales presentation.
So naturally, he got on an airplane to meet his first prospective customer.
This episode explores one of the most important lessons of entrepreneurship: starting a business doesn’t mean you’re ready. It means you’re committed. Readiness comes later, through action, mistakes, pressure, customer questions, and the uncomfortable process of becoming the person your business requires.
Based on Mike Konrad’s book, The Reluctant Entrepreneur: Anatomy of a Business Startup, From Uncertainty to Unstoppable.
